Thư viện tri thức trực tuyến
Kho tài liệu với 50,000+ tài liệu học thuật
© 2023 Siêu thị PDF - Kho tài liệu học thuật hàng đầu Việt Nam

BÀI 1 TẠO LẬP VÀ GHÉP NỐI CÁC MÔ HÌNH HÀM TRUYỀN ĐẠT.docx
Nội dung xem thử
Mô tả chi tiết
TRƯỜNG ĐẠI HỌC HÀNG HẢI VIỆT NAM
KHOA ĐIỆN-ĐIỆN TỬ
BÁO CÁO THỰC HÀNH
HỌC PHẦN: LÍ THUYẾT ĐIỀU KHIỂN TỰ ĐỘNG
MÃ HỌC PHẦN : 13434H
SINH VIÊN: ĐINH NGỌC HUÂN
MÃ SINH VIÊN:92830
NHÓM: N01.TH1
GIẢNG VIÊN: LÊ THỊ THANH TÂM
1
BÀI 1: TẠO LẬP VÀ GHÉP NỐI CÁC MÔ HÌNH HÀM
TRUYỀN ĐẠT.
I.C s lí thuy t ơ ở ế
1. Khái ni m hàm truy n đ t ệ ề ạ
- Hàm truy n đ t là t s gi a nh Laplace c a tín hi u ra ề ạ ỷ ố ữ ả ủ ệ
và nh Laplace c a tín hi u vào v i các đi u ki n ban đ u ả ủ ệ ớ ề ệ ầ
b ng 0. ằ
- Kí hi u: ệ G(s)
- Công th c t ng quát: ứ ổ
G(s)= Y (s)
U (s)
=
bm s
m
+bm−1 s
m−1
+…+b1 s+b0
an
s
n
+an−1
s
n−1
+…+a1
s+a0
-Đây là d ng h p th c c a hàm truy n đ t. Là 1 phân th c ạ ợ ứ ủ ề ạ ứ
trong đó có t và m u đ u là 1 đa th c đ i v i bi n s (m≤n) ử ẫ ề ứ ố ớ ế
2. T o l p hàm hàm truy n đ t trong MATLAB ạ ậ ề ạ
a¿G1 (s)= Y (s)
U (s)
=
bm s
m
+bm−1 s
m−1
+…+b1 s+b0
an
s
n
+an−1
s
n−1
+…+a1
s+a0
Num=[ bm
bm−1…b0
¿
Den=[ an an−1…a0 ]
Hàm truy n đ t c a h : S d ng l nh ề ạ ủ ệ ử ụ ệ
sys=tf(num,den)
b ¿G2 (s) =
k .(s−z0) (s−z1 ) …(s−zm
)
(s−p0) (s−p1) …(s−pn
)
P=[ p0 p1… pn
¿
Z=[ z0
z1…zm ]
K=const
2
Hàm truy n đ t h : S d ng l nh ề ạ ệ ử ụ ệ
sys=zpk(Z,P,k)
- N u 2 hàm truy n đ t ghép n i ti p nhau, s d ng ế ề ạ ố ế ử ụ
l nh: sys=series(sys1,sys2) ệ
- N u có trên 2 hàm ghép n i ti p, s d ng l nh: ế ố ế ử ụ ệ
sys=sys1*sys2*….*sysn
- N u 2 hàm truy n đ t ghép song song, s d ng l nh: ế ề ạ ử ụ ệ
sys=parallel(sys1,sys2)
- N u 2 hàm truy n đ t ghép n i ph n h i âm, s ế ề ạ ố ả ồ ử
d ng l nh: sys=feedback(sys1,sys2) ụ ệ
Ph n h i âm đ n v : sys2=1 ả ồ ơ ị
N u 2 hàm truy n đ t ghép n i ph n h i d ng , s ế ề ạ ố ả ồ ươ ử
d ng l nh: sys=feedback(sys1,-sys2) ụ ệ
Ph n h i d ng đ n v : sys2=-1) ả ồ ươ ơ ị
II. N i Dung Th c Hành ộ ự
4.1. T o l p hàm truy n đ t c a m t h đi u khi n liên ạ ậ ề ạ ủ ộ ệ ề ể
t c tuy n tính trong Matlab ụ ế
a,
>> num1=[1 -3 5 -1];
den1=[4 -1 2 -1 1];
sys1=tf(num1,den1)
sys1 =
s^3 - 3 s^2 + 5 s - 1
---------------------------
3
4 s^4 - s^3 + 2 s^2 - s + 1
b,
>> z=[];
p=[-2 -4];
k=5;
sys2=zpk(z,p,k)
sys2 =
5
-----------
(s+2) (s+4)
4.2. Tìm hàm truyền đạt của một hệ điều khiển tự động liên
tục tuyến tính bao gồm nhiều khối ghép nối với nhau trong
Matlab
a,
sys1=tf([1 -2],[3 1 1 -1]);
sys2=tf([1 1],[1 -3]);
4